Yeah, I'm not sure whether I outlined that in my tutorials, but with
anything past... I think it was the December 2006 SDK or something like
that, you'll probably get that compilation error. I'm not sure whether
'linear' was a new datatype added in that SDK or something, but you can just
run through common_fxc.h and rename every variable called 'linear', and it
still works fine

> Upon attempting to run fxc.exe directly from the command line, I have no
> trouble so I assume my path is set correctly, however there are compilition
> errors. Shouldn't these have come up when running the .bat though if
> fxc.exe was ever being run at all? And more importaintly, the compilation
> error is:
>
> common_fxc.h<156,36>: error X3000: syntax error: unexpected token 'linear'
>
> This is one of the included valve header files, and looking at the section
> in that file:
>
> float3 LinearToGamma( const float3 linear ) //this is line 156
> {
> return pow( linear, 1.0f / 2.2f );
> }
>
> I can't find anything wrong there, can you?

> > Having a space in your path to the mod can cause them to incorrectly
> copy,
> > but it should also produce an error when running buildsdkshaders.bat
> > There should be a directory in the shaders directory where the FXC files
> > are
> > compiled to (Can't remember the name off the top of my head). The shaders
> > are then copied from there to your mod directory. I'd check if they are
> in
> > that directory first (just search stdshaders directory for *.fxc). If
> they
> > are, its just an error in the copy process, and you can just fix up the
> > batch file yourself if you really want, just hardcode in a copy. If they
> > aren't there, then theres some other error in the compilation process
> that
> > you're missing.
> > Make sure you're running buildsdkshaders.bat from the command-line as
> well,
> > because you often don't see any errors if you just double-click it, coz
> the
> > window closes pretty quickly once its done compiling the combos.
